This portable gas analyzer is engineered to deliver laboratory-grade toxic gas measurement in environments where ignition risk must be controlled. Designed for use in hazardous (classified) areas and undergoing intrinsic safety certification, the instrument combines trace-level sensitivity with rugged field readiness, enabling reliable detection in refineries, chemical plants, confined spaces, and other potentially explosive atmospheres.
An integrated active sampling pump continuously draws air across the sensor for fast response and stable readings, while high-capacity rechargeable lithium-ion batteries provide a full shift of operation. Measurement data are presented on a clear digital display with live trend visualization, and onboard memory automatically records exposure history for documentation and compliance tracking. Configurable audible and visual alarms provide immediate warning when gas concentrations approach or exceed defined thresholds.
- Intrinsic Safety Architecture for Hazardous Environments: Designed in accordance with intrinsic safety principles defined in IEC 60079-11, the analyzer is intended for operation in flammable or explosive atmospheres without introducing an ignition source. Intrinsic safety certification is currently in finalization. This enables direct measurement at the point of risk rather than relying on remote sampling or indirect inference.
- Field-Ready Portability: A compact, impact-resistant enclosure and balanced handheld form factor support extended use in demanding field conditions. Long-duration battery operation minimizes downtime and supports continuous monitoring across an entire work period.
- System Connectivity and Integration: Standard analog and digital output options allow the analyzer to interface with plant safety systems, data loggers, and control platforms. This supports centralized monitoring, archival storage, and integration into existing EHS workflows.
- Rugged Industrial Construction: The enclosure is engineered for durability in harsh industrial settings, resisting vibration, dust, and temperature variation. The design prioritizes reliability in real-world environments where instruments are exposed to physical and environmental stress.
- Clear Data and Simple Operation: A high-contrast numeric display with live graphical feedback makes concentration trends easy to interpret in real time. Automatic data logging simplifies recordkeeping, exposure verification, and reporting, reducing administrative burden and supporting compliance documentation.

Specifications
| Intrinsic Safety (Certification Pending) | Class I, Division 1 Groups A, B, C and D, Intrinsically Safe (pending) |
| Class I, Zone 0 AEx ia IIC T4 Ga (USA) (pending) | |
| Ex ia IIC T4 Ga (Canada) (pending) | |
| Ambient Temperature Range: 32°F – 113°F (0°C – 45°C) | |
| T4 Temperature Classification is assumed at this time (pending) | |
| Accuracy | 5% |
| Display | Sunlight visible transflective LCD |
| Internal Battery | Rechargeable Lithium-Ion (5000 mAh) |
| Data Logging | Via integral SD card (32 GB) |
| Dimensions | 5½ in H x 8¼ in W x 10 in D (140 x 210 x 254 mm) Includes body and legs |
| Weight | 6.5 lb (2.95 kg) |
| Enclosure | Anodized aluminum |
| Power (when plugged in) | Universal AC outlet adapter. Rated voltage 100-240V, 50/60hz, USB A. Total output: 5V, 2400 mA or higher. |
| Calibration | Against standard gas mixture, or via Interscan’s SENSOR EXPRESS® |
